用于文件夹中数据的数据脱敏同步方法及系统与流程
- 国知局
- 2024-07-31 23:12:23
本发明涉及网络数据配置领域,具体涉及一种用于文件夹中数据的数据脱敏同步方法及系统。
背景技术:
1、大数据时代,数据存在多种存储方式,在一些政府、机构或者企业中有很多重要数据会以文件夹的方式存储。为了让其他用户调用这些数据,需要将文件夹中的数据写入到一个可供调用的目标数据库中。为了在其他用户调用数据的同时避免敏感数据泄露(例如用户需要获取张三的身份地址信息,但是张三的身份证号为敏感数据,需要保密),收到用户的数据调用请求后,会对调用的数据进行人工查找到敏感数据后,对敏感数据进行数据脱敏(对敏感数据进行变形,例如遮挡部分或者全部敏感数据)。
2、但是,人工查找敏感数据并进行数据脱敏的工作效率较低,而且对于不同的数据需要进行不同敏感数据识别和数据脱敏流程,操作过程比较复杂;与此同时,人工查找敏感数据的精度有待提高。
技术实现思路
1、针对现有技术中存在的缺陷,本发明解决的技术问题为:如何自动将文件夹中的敏感数据进行数据脱敏、并同步至目标数据库中,进而简化操作流程,提高工作效率和数据脱敏精度。
2、为达到以上目的,第一方面,本申请实施例提供一种用于文件夹中数据的数据脱敏同步方法,包括以下步骤:将文件夹的数据同步至目标数据库时,根据设置的敏感关键词获取文件夹中对应的敏感数据,根据设置的脱敏方式对敏感数据进行数据脱敏后同步至目标数据库。
3、结合第一方面,在一种实施方式中,所述脱敏关键词的设置流程包括:对不同的数据调用用户设置对应的敏感关键词,为每个敏感关键词设置对应的脱敏方式。
4、结合第一方面,在一种实施方式中,所述为每个敏感关键词设置对应的脱敏方式的流程包括:将所有敏感关键词分成禁止知晓类别和独占知晓类别,禁止知晓类别的脱敏方式为字符遮盖,独占知晓类别的加密方式为加密算法;将采用加密算法进行数据脱敏的敏感数据同步至目标数据库时,还会将该加密算法对应的解密密钥存储至目标数据库中的指定位置。
5、结合第一方面,在一种实施方式中,所述根据设置的脱敏方式对敏感数据进行数据脱敏后同步至目标数据库的流程包括:获取需要同步的文件夹数据,设置文件夹数据的敏感关键词和对应的脱敏方式;根据当前文件夹信息创建数据同步任务,根据敏感关键词和脱敏方式创建数据脱敏任务;在进行数据同步任务的过程中执行数据脱敏任务。
6、结合第一方面,在一种实施方式中,所述获取需要同步的文件夹数据的流程包括:当需要同步的文件夹数据为本地文件时,将本地文件上传至服务器;当需要同步的文件夹数据为服务器上已经存在的文件时,在服务器上选中对应的文件。
7、结合第一方面,在一种实施方式中,所述设置文件夹数据的敏感关键词和对应的脱敏方式的流程包括:对文件夹数据进行解析得到表头对象和业务数据清单,根据表头对象设置脱敏关键词和对应的脱敏方式。
8、结合第一方面,在一种实施方式中,所述数据同步任务的创建流程包括:确定目标数据库和目标数据表,根据当前文件夹地址配置目标数据库的导入路径;配置当前文件夹的表头对象与目标数据表的表头对象的映射关系。
9、结合第一方面,在一种实施方式中,所述数据脱敏任务的创建流程包括:将当前文件夹数据的敏感关键词和对应的脱敏方式保存至同步任务的任务执行文件中。
10、结合第一方面,在一种实施方式中,所述在进行数据同步任务的过程中执行数据脱敏任务的过程包括:根据目标数据库的导入路径导入解析后的文件夹数据;根据表头对象的映射关系,将文件夹中的非敏感数据同步至目标数据库;对文件夹中的敏感数据进行数据脱敏后,根据表头对象的映射关系同步至目标数据库。
11、第二方面,本申请实施例提供了一种用于文件夹中数据的数据脱敏同步系统,用于执行第一方面提供的方法。
12、与现有技术相比,本发明的优点在于:
13、与现有技术中的人工查找敏感数据并进行数据脱敏相比,本发明将文件夹的数据同步至目标数据库时,能够根据预先设置的关键词和脱敏方式,自动获取敏感数据并进行数据脱敏,不仅不需要人工干预,操作流程简单,工作效率较高,而且根据上述方式查找到的脱敏数据的精度较高。
技术特征:1.一种用于文件夹中数据的数据脱敏同步方法,其特征在于,该方法包括以下步骤:将文件夹的数据同步至目标数据库时,根据设置的敏感关键词获取文件夹中对应的敏感数据,根据设置的脱敏方式对敏感数据进行数据脱敏后同步至目标数据库。
2.如权利要求1所述的用于文件夹中数据的数据脱敏同步方法,其特征在于,所述脱敏关键词的设置流程包括:对不同的数据调用用户设置对应的敏感关键词,为每个敏感关键词设置对应的脱敏方式。
3.如权利要求2所述的用于文件夹中数据的数据脱敏同步方法,其特征在于,所述为每个敏感关键词设置对应的脱敏方式的流程包括:将所有敏感关键词分成禁止知晓类别和独占知晓类别,禁止知晓类别的脱敏方式为字符遮盖,独占知晓类别的加密方式为加密算法;将采用加密算法进行数据脱敏的敏感数据同步至目标数据库时,还会将该加密算法对应的解密密钥存储至目标数据库中的指定位置。
4.如权利要求1至3任一项所述的用于文件夹中数据的数据脱敏同步方法,其特征在于,所述根据设置的脱敏方式对敏感数据进行数据脱敏后同步至目标数据库的流程包括:获取需要同步的文件夹数据,设置文件夹数据的敏感关键词和对应的脱敏方式;根据当前文件夹信息创建数据同步任务,根据敏感关键词和脱敏方式创建数据脱敏任务;在进行数据同步任务的过程中执行数据脱敏任务。
5.如权利要求4所述的用于文件夹中数据的数据脱敏同步方法,其特征在于,所述获取需要同步的文件夹数据的流程包括:当需要同步的文件夹数据为本地文件时,将本地文件上传至服务器;当需要同步的文件夹数据为服务器上已经存在的文件时,在服务器上选中对应的文件。
6.如权利要求5所述的用于文件夹中数据的数据脱敏同步方法,其特征在于,所述设置文件夹数据的敏感关键词和对应的脱敏方式的流程包括:对文件夹数据进行解析得到表头对象和业务数据清单,根据表头对象设置脱敏关键词和对应的脱敏方式。
7.如权利要求6所述的用于文件夹中数据的数据脱敏同步方法,其特征在于,所述数据同步任务的创建流程包括:确定目标数据库和目标数据表,根据当前文件夹地址配置目标数据库的导入路径;配置当前文件夹的表头对象与目标数据表的表头对象的映射关系。
8.如权利要求7所述的用于文件夹中数据的数据脱敏同步方法,其特征在于,所述数据脱敏任务的创建流程包括:将当前文件夹数据的敏感关键词和对应的脱敏方式保存至同步任务的任务执行文件中。
9.如权利要求8所述的用于文件夹中数据的数据脱敏同步方法,其特征在于,所述在进行数据同步任务的过程中执行数据脱敏任务的过程包括:根据目标数据库的导入路径导入解析后的文件夹数据;根据表头对象的映射关系,将文件夹中的非敏感数据同步至目标数据库;对文件夹中的敏感数据进行数据脱敏后,根据表头对象的映射关系同步至目标数据库。
10.一种用于文件夹中数据的数据脱敏同步系统,其特征在于:该系统用于执行权利要求1至9任一项所述的方法。
技术总结本发明公开了一种用于文件夹中数据的数据脱敏同步方法及系统,涉及网络数据配置领域。该方法的流程包括:将文件夹的数据同步至目标数据库时,根据设置的敏感关键词获取文件夹中对应的敏感数据,根据设置的脱敏方式对敏感数据进行数据脱敏后同步至目标数据库。本发明将文件夹的数据同步至目标数据库时,能够根据预先设置的关键词和脱敏方式,自动获取敏感数据并进行数据脱敏,不仅不需要人工干预,操作流程简单,工作效率较高,而且根据上述方式查找到的脱敏数据的精度较高。技术研发人员:熊伟受保护的技术使用者:中电云计算技术有限公司技术研发日:技术公布日:2024/7/29本文地址:https://www.jishuxx.com/zhuanli/20240730/196404.html
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 YYfuon@163.com 举报,一经查实,本站将立刻删除。